Washing Systems for Biodiesel Purification
The washing stage in biodiesel refining begins after decantation of the transesterification reaction, aiming at the rigorous purification of the final product. Through the acidified water washing method, critical contaminants such as free glycerin, soaps, salt residues, excess alcohol, and catalyst are removed. Clark Solutions’ systems use columns equipped with high-performance random packing, which increase the contact area and interaction time between the liquid phases. This advanced engineering ensures proper dispersion, prevents droplet shearing, and enables efficient mass transfer, resulting in a high-purity product with full technical compliance.
